## Runbook: userd split cut-over

Heads up — once the Lanternfish monolith stops owning user records, all auth traffic flows through the new userd service. Flip the router flag only after the backfill job reports zero pending rows; otherwise logins will bounce. Rollback is just flipping the flag back, no data loss. Keep an eye on the p99 latency dashboard for the first hour. Before you start, confirm the staging values match what's deployed, listed here for reference:

deployment values, kajep-kageg:
[praix]
host = praix.paliqcorp.corp
user = praix_svc
database = praix_prod

## Formula sandbox tuning

User-supplied formulas in Gridmoor execute inside a restricted interpreter with hard ceilings on time, memory, and call depth. Reviewers should confirm any change to these ceilings is justified in the PR description, since raising them widens the abuse surface. Defaults were chosen from production traces. The current limits are as follows.

limits module of tafog-fawip:
WEIGHTS = {
    "julix": 57,
    "lamys": 992,
    "kasvan": 209,
    "quenok": 750,
    "alddor": 259,
    "oliath": 1009,
    "wenix": 815,
}

## Seat-map renderer blank on Gallery level

For the eng sync: the Pavilion Rose seat-map renderer returns an empty SVG when the Gallery tier has zero priced seats. Workaround is to re-run the pricing sync, then clear the render cache. To trigger a manual re-render against staging, call the render endpoint with the token below.

login token, bagug-kafop: eyJhbGciOiJIUzI1NiIsInR5cCI6IkpXVCJ9.eyJzdWIiOiIcMLov2In0.Z5RLDIfp